Here are some easy tips for finding clothes to suit you in the sizes that fit you best.
It’s really best to avoid “flowing” fabrics, but you want to find fabric that breathes. It’s normal to be attracted to clothes, and shirts mainly, that have a ‘flowing’ look to them. Fabrics of this kind tend to feel good to touch, and they provide for good air circulation. But looks are deceptive because they will make you look larger and heavier.
Cotton or blended fabrics will really be the best choice, here. The good thing about these fabrics is they will not create that appearance because they are stiffer, less flowy, and they also allow for air to circulate. Sizes are not uniform, you can find shirts that really are the same size in different stores – but in one store it may be an XL and in a different one it’s XXL, or XXXL.
Always ask about a store’s returns policy, and never make assumptions about the size on the label. You can be more efficient if you know your measurements, that way when you enter a store you can just start looking in the right places. Begin looking at sizes that are one up from what you think your size is. The trick is that if the item is too large, or too small, you’ll know which direction you’ll need to go and it’s just the next size.
Try to find fabrics that can offer you some support for your frame. Rather than choosing slacks or khaki pants, try on some denim jeans, as these can hold more weight for bigger men. Denim can be great for holding in some of the weight, while pants in a lighter fabric could actually make your curves more prominent. Choose your fabrics carefully. Light and flowy fabrics might breathe better but they can also make you look bigger than you really are.
